Bin Cheng and Sergey Zelik at meeting on Dynamical Systems in Russia

Bin Cheng and Sergey Zelik are in Nizhny Novgorod, which is about 400 km southeast of Moscow, this week (2-9 July) for the “International Conference on Dynamics, Bifurcations, and Strange Attractors“, hosted by Lobachevsky State University.
